MeetMagnet
Meet Magnet est une startup innovante spécialisée dans la recherche avancée de prospects. Fondée par Étienne Douillard et Matthias Robert, l'entreprise se consacre à identifier les individus ayant la plus forte probabilité d'être intéressés par l'offre de leurs clients. Grâce à des techniques de ciblage de pointe, Meet Magnet optimise la prospection commerciale, garantissant ainsi une efficacité maximale pour ses partenaires. J'ai eu le privilège d'y effectuer mon stage, contribuant à cette mission ambitieuse et enrichissante.

Migration de base de données
Pour débuter mon stage, j'ai commencé par explorer de nouvelles technologies telles que n8n et Bubble, avec lesquelles je n'avais pas encore d'expérience. J'ai également renforcé mes connaissances en Notion et Google Sheets, des outils que j'utilisais déjà. Ce processus m'a permis d'établir les bases nécessaires avant d'explorer les bases de données et d'évaluer leurs avantages et inconvénients respectifs.
En collaboration avec mon camarade de classe avec qui je fais mon stage, nous avons décidé d'opter pour MongoDB après une analyse approfondie. Nous avons ensuite entrepris de migrer leurs données depuis Google Sheets vers MongoDB, en adaptant chaque nœud nécessaire dans leur workflow sur n8n. Initialement choisi pour sa clarté visuelle, Google Sheets a été remplacé par MongoDB pour mieux répondre à leurs besoins croissants.
Avant:

Après:

Workflow de recherche d'influenceurs
J'ai conçu trois workflows distincts dans n8n pour automatiser des processus critiques. Le premier workflow est dédié à la récupération des utilisateurs premium en premier lieu, suivis des utilisateurs freemium qui n'ont pas encore atteint leur limite mensuelle de prospects. Ce workflow est programmé pour s'exécuter quotidiennement à une heure précise, assurant ainsi une gestion efficace et opportune des utilisateurs.
Le deuxième workflow que j'ai développé se concentre sur le matchmaking entre les influenceurs LinkedIn et la solution proposée par le client. Ce processus permet d'identifier et de connecter de manière automatisée les influenceurs dont le profil correspond aux besoins spécifiques du produit ou du service promus par l'utilisateur, facilitant ainsi une approche ciblée et personnalisée.
Enfin, le troisième workflow vise à mettre en relation les individus ayant aimé les publications des influenceurs avec les attentes spécifiques du client. Cela optimise la stratégie de ciblage et de conversion en fonction des préférences et des comportements des prospects potentiels.
Workflow 1:

Workflow 2 partie 1:

Workflow 2 partie 2:

Workflow 3:

Installation d'une interface de gestion sur le VPS
Pendant mon stage, j'ai mis en place une interface web de gestion appelée Cockpit sur le VPS de mes tuteurs sous Ubuntu. Cette plateforme permet à mes superviseurs de surveiller en temps réel plusieurs aspects cruciaux de leur serveur. Ils peuvent ainsi visualiser l'utilisation de la RAM, du processeur, du disque, ainsi que l'espace de stockage disponible. Cette solution leur offre la possibilité de prendre des décisions éclairées sur les charges de travail qu'ils peuvent lancer simultanément sans risquer de rencontrer des problèmes techniques ou des ralentissements.

Workflow de backup
J'ai développé un workflow sur n8n qui automatise la récupération, la conversion en JSON et le stockage des workflows existants dans un dossier dédié sur Google Drive, identifié par la date du jour. De plus, le workflow inclut une fonctionnalité de nettoyage automatique qui supprime les sauvegardes datant de plus de 30 jours, permettant ainsi une gestion efficiente de l'espace de stockage et évitant tout gaspillage inutile de ressources.

Installation de n8n sur le VPS de dev
J'ai installé n8n sur le VPS de développement de mes tuteurs en utilisant Docker, afin de le maintenir isolé du reste de l'infrastructure. Cette approche a permis une gestion plus efficace des ressources et une meilleure sécurité en créant un environnement de développement dédié et facilement configurable.
Workflow de mail journalier aux prospects
J'ai développé un workflow automatisé qui envoie des e-mails aux utilisateurs dès que nous identifions de nouveaux prospects dans les dernières 24 heures. Ce workflow est programmé pour s'exécuter à une heure précise chaque jour. Pour créer ces e-mails, je me suis appuyé sur un modèle HTML fourni par mon tuteur que j'ai adapté. J'ai intégré du JavaScript dans n8n pour dynamiquement ajouter une liste de prospects, ce qui permet une personnalisation flexible en fonction des résultats obtenus.

